Warning Signs You Need HVAC Leak Water Removal
Catching the signs of an HVAC leak early on can save you a world of trouble and expense.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your home,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ore the smell it’s a clear indication that something’s amiss.
Water Stains or Warping on Ceilings or Floors
Water damage can cause unsightly stains or warping on your ceilings or floors. Don’t delay in addressing the issue, it can lead to costly repairs.
Increased Energy Bills
If you notice a sudden spike in your energy bills, it could be a sign that your HVAC system is working harder than usual, and that’s often a sign of a leak. Check your bills and see if there’s a pattern.
Visible Water Leaks or Drips
This one’s a no-brainer, if you see water leaking from your HVAC system, it’s time to act fast. Don’t wait call us immediately.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
If you notice unusual noises or sounds coming from your HVAC system, it could be a sign that something’s amiss. Don’t ignore the sounds they could be a warning sign.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old and mildew growth can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t delay in addressing the issue, it can lead to serious health concerns.

HVAC Leak Water Removal Cost in Chelmsford, MA
The cost of HVAC le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Chelmsford, MA. These estimates are based on typical scenarios and may not reflect your specific situation. Get a free estimate from our team to find out the best course of action for your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Detection | $100 – $500 | Severity of leak, size of affected area, and equipment needed |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, equipment needed, and labor required |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and labor required |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, materials needed, and labor required |
| More Services (mold remediation, etc.) |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of issue, equipment needed, and labor required |

Common Questions About HVAC Leak Water Removal
Will I need to replace my entire HVAC system if I have a leak?
Not necessarily. In many cases, a leak can be repaired without replacing the entire system. Our team will assess the situation and provide you with a clear understanding of what needs to be done. We’ll help you find out the best course of action.
How long will it take to dry my property after a leak?
The drying process can take anywhere from a few days to a week or more, depending on the sever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. Our team will work closely with you to ensure that your property is safe and dry as soon as possible. We’ll keep you updated on the progress.
